| Oh, and just to make you feel really good: Every 10 INT gives you 1 more MP at level up. So sure, you have more MP now. But every single level, for the rest of your maple career, will net you 2 less MP than someone who added int. In a 50 or 60 levels, they will catch up, and then have more MP. |
